Thanks for the patch to the Pedalwise rebalancer. One thing plugin authors should know: the dispatch scorer weights station deficit against truck travel time, and your hook runs after the decay factor is applied, not before. If you override the scoring callback, keep your outputs in the normalized 0–1 range or the scheduler in the Bramford depot build will clamp them silently. For reference, these are the defaults your plugin inherits unless you explicitly override them.

tuning constants:
QUOTAS = {
    "druwyn": 5,
    "holix": 5,
    "zorath": 5,
    "holwyn": 10,
}

### SDK Parity Check (Kestrel vs. Lanternfly)

Welcome aboard! Before shipping anything, run the parity script — it diffs the public API surface of the Kestrel (mobile) and Lanternfly (web) SDKs and flags anything one has that the other doesn't. Don't hand-wave mismatches; file them, even tiny ones. When the script passes, paste its output into the tracker along with the build token printed below.

build token for yahig-haduf: htk9_c784e8425

## Limits & Quotas: Soft Deletes in `orders`

Quick heads-up for the sync: Marrowgate's orders table keeps soft-deleted rows around for reconciliation, and the tombstone count is starting to drag down the nightly sweep. We cap how many rows the purge job touches per run so it doesn't lock out checkout writes. If the backlog grows, bump the batch size before touching the retention window. The current quota values are listed here.

limits module of kahap-baguf:
QUOTAS = {
    "lamius": 873,
    "holiel": 809,
    "silmir": 252,
    "kaswyn": 562,
    "jorox": 1004,
}

Quarterly Planning Note — Divestiture of the Coastal Tooling Unit

For the finance team: the sale of the Coastal Tooling unit to Pellmark Industries remains on track for close in Q3. Please finalize the carve-out balance sheet, reconcile intercompany positions, and prepare the working-capital adjustment schedule by month-end. Audit support requests should be prioritized. For planning purposes, note the following sensitive item:

internal memo for hawef-kahif: The finance team signed off on a budget of $25.9 million for Project Sorox. The renewal with Pelokek Logistics closes at $51.7 million a year, 52 percent below the last contract.